Drawing on the testimony of leaders and residents of three communities in Nicaragua, Costa Rica, and Panama, this title explores grassroots assumptions, values, and practices of sustainable development and, in particular, the ways in which they overlap with or challenge international financial institutions' discourse of sustainability.
